Who Is Zaya Wade?

Zaya Wade, the daughter of NBA legend Dwyane Wade and actress Gabrielle Union, has grown up in the spotlight. She came out as transgender in 2020 at just 12 years old, and since then, she’s become a prominent voice in the LGBTQ+ community. With her parents’ full support, she’s stepped into modeling, advocacy, and even music collaborations. But lately, she’s been linked to something a little less serious—her very own meme song.

What Is the “Zaya Wade Song”?

You might not know the official title of the track, but if you’ve seen the TikTok videos, you’ve definitely heard it. It’s usually the remix version of “No Cap” by Mannie B, and it’s been clipped, looped, and reuploaded countless times. The beat is catchy, the lyrics are simple, and the vibe is just quirky enough to catch on. People use it to soundtrack all sorts of moments—some sincere, some silly.

How Did This Sound Become So Popular?

It started small. A few creators used the audio in their videos, mostly for lighthearted takes on family moments or dad jokes. But then something happened—TikTok users started pairing it with memes involving Zaya and her dad, Dwyane Wade. Suddenly, it wasn’t just a remix; it was “the Zaya Wade song.” And once it got that label, the floodgates opened.

Why Is It Called the “Zaya Wade Song”?

Well, it’s not exactly an official title. More like a fan-given nickname. Since Dwyane Wade is such a well-known figure, and Zaya has been in the public eye since her early teens, their family moments get attention. When the “dih” sound started showing up in videos that also featured Zaya or her dad, people started calling it by her name. It stuck, and now it’s part of the internet lexicon.

Where Did the “Dih” Meme Come From?

Before it was linked to Zaya, the word “dih” was floating around online as a slang term. Some say it’s short for “dude,” others argue it’s a way of mocking someone’s reaction. Either way, it caught on. The earliest known examples of the meme started showing up on TikTok around late December 2024, usually paired with that same catchy remix.

What Does “Dih” Mean Anyway?

That’s the thing—nobody’s entirely sure. It’s kind of like internet slang in its purest form: flexible, playful, and open to interpretation. Some people use it to call someone out, others use it for comedic effect. It’s not exactly a deep word, but it’s got staying power. And now, thanks to the “Zaya Wade song,” it’s everywhere.
